Allein is a typical small mountain village situated on a splendid sunny position on the left side of the Artanavaz river, 15 km from Aosta on the SS 27 Great Saint Bernard road. Sightseeing: in the hamlet of Ayez, there is an ancient house dating back to the 15th century with some particularly decorative worked-stone windows with a characteristic ogee motif. This building has been restored and become the seat of a museum and a library. The territory of Allein offers a wide range of paths and itineraries for summer excursions, the most important is the one to Mont Saron (2631 mt), a peak which is easy to reach and which is also the destination of an annual religious procession taking place at the end of July. Talking about folklore, worthy of mention is Carnival which is celebrated by the population of the village in the month of February with a parade of multicoloured and typical costumes which recall the uniforms of Napoleonic soldiers. The typical festival of this village is called “Feta di Trifolle” dedicated to the potato which takes place every year at the end of August. |
